What does a physical security access control manager do?

A Physical Security Access Control Manager is responsible for overseeing the security systems and procedures that control who can enter or exit a facility or specific areas within it. They manage access control technologies such as key cards, biometric scanners, and security badges, and ensure that only authorized personnel have entry to sensitive areas. In addition, they develop and enforce security policies, conduct risk assessments, and coordinate with security staff to respond to incidents or breaches. Their role is crucial in protecting people, property, and sensitive information from unauthorized access.

What are the key skills and qualifications needed to thrive as a physical security access control manager?

To thrive as a Physical Security Access Control Manager, you need expertise in security protocols, risk assessment, and access control systems, often supported by a degree in security management or a related field. Familiarity with access control software (e.g., Lenel, HID), CCTV systems, and certifications like CPP (Certified Protection Professional) are typically required. Strong leadership, problem-solving ability, and excellent communication skills help manage teams and coordinate with stakeholders. These skills ensure the effective safeguarding of facilities, personnel, and assets against unauthorized access and potential threats.

How does a physical security access control manager typically collaborate with other departments to ensure facility security?

A Physical Security Access Control Manager works closely with IT, HR, facilities management, and executive leadership to develop and enforce access policies. Collaboration with IT is crucial for integrating electronic access systems and ensuring cybersecurity alignment, while HR assists with onboarding and offboarding procedures related to access rights. Regular coordination with facilities teams helps maintain and upgrade physical security hardware, and clear communication with leadership ensures policies support organizational goals. This cross-functional teamwork is essential to address emerging threats and maintain a secure environment.
